The importance of activating root chakra healing

Many people who are not as experienced as others in chakra energy healing would ask which chakra in the chakra system should be activated first. And spirituality experts would tell them the same answer: Root chakra.

The root chakra or Muladhara chakra needs to be activated first because the root chakra holds and grounds all the other chakras or the other energy centers. It also plays an integral role in maintaining the chakra system’s function and that the energy flows smoothly. And on top of that, it ensures the other energy centers are in good condition.

The importance of starting from the root chakra lies in the universal order of the chakra wheel system. Each one of the seven chakras — root chakra, sacral chakra, solar plexus chakra, throat chakra, heart chakra, third eye chakra, and crown chakra — serves a unique purpose. And for each chakra to fulfill that purpose, the chakra wheel’s foundation needs to be established well.

Use essential oils

The root chakra represents a solid foundation, and therefore reaching for earthy essential oils seems appropriate. Essential oil helps ground, stabilize, calm, and heal, as well as enhances the naturally occurring energy within your entire body. 

The root chakra can benefit from grounding, so essential oils from trees can be useful. Use oils such as cedarwood, frankincense, vetiver, and sandalwood.

2 – Look after your physical body

Diet

Start being selective of what you eat. Rather than simply consume every food in front of you, enjoy the privilege of saying NO to artificial food. Fruits, crops, and, root vegetables, for example, are great options. Go with these foods instead of just anything that appears tasty.

Additionally, eliminate artificially sweetened drinks, carbonated refreshments, and other manufactured beverages. In lieu of them, drink water and healthy juices.

Engage in physical exercise and rest

Move around and let your physical body feel revitalized. You can move around any way you want. 

You may go running, biking, jogging, or brisk walking. You may also go to the gym and use gym equipment to build your muscles.

But as you focus on building muscles, do your best not to over-exert any muscle and be prone to over-exhaustion. To remedy problems with over-exhaustion give yourself adequate amounts of rest.

Spend time in nature

A way to break down negative energy and thoughts is to get outdoors and connect with the earth. All the primary chakras connect to the physical universe and an effective way to strengthen these connections is to explore them in nature.

Spending time in nature is also a way of eliminating stress. Especially if you work in an office for hours for a series of days, a break like this is helpful to maintain your wellbeing.

How you spend time in nature is up to you. And it doesn’t matter. What matters is you do it regularly and make a habit out of it.

Try walking barefoot in sand or dirt, feel the sunlight in your eyes, or bathe in the ocean. It’s a nice idea to simply admire and enjoy the beautiful views of forests.
